The Body's Transition: From Glucose to Fat

When you stop eating for a full day, your body goes through several metabolic stages. The initial hours are spent using the glucose from your last meal. After this, your body begins to tap into its stored glucose, called glycogen, primarily located in the liver and muscles.

The Stages of a 24-Hour Fast

  • The Fed State (0-4 hours): Immediately after your last meal, your body is in the fed state, digesting food and absorbing nutrients. Blood glucose and insulin levels are elevated, and the body uses this glucose for energy.
  • The Early Fasting State (4-12 hours): As time passes, blood glucose and insulin levels begin to drop. Your body accesses its glycogen stores for energy to maintain stable blood sugar levels.
  • Gluconeogenesis and Ketosis (12-24 hours): By the 12 to 24-hour mark, your liver's glycogen reserves are typically depleted. The body enters gluconeogenesis, producing new glucose from non-carbohydrate sources like protein, and shifts into a mild state of ketosis, breaking down fat for fuel. This metabolic switch to burning fat can offer benefits such as weight loss and improved insulin sensitivity.

Potential Benefits of a Single-Day Fast

Many people practice a 24-hour fast as a form of intermittent fasting (IF) and report various benefits.

  • Weight Loss: By restricting calorie intake for a day, you can reduce your overall weekly calorie count, leading to weight loss. The metabolic shift to burning fat also contributes to this. However, it is crucial not to overeat on non-fasting days to negate this effect.
  • Improved Metabolic Health: Research suggests that intermittent fasting can improve insulin sensitivity and help regulate blood sugar levels, potentially reducing the risk of type 2 diabetes.
  • Enhanced Cellular Repair (Autophagy): Fasting triggers autophagy, a cellular cleaning process where the body removes and recycles damaged cells and proteins. This can contribute to overall health and longevity.
  • Cardiovascular Health: Some studies indicate that intermittent fasting may help improve heart health by reducing risk factors like blood pressure and cholesterol levels.

Side Effects and Risks to Consider

While generally safe for healthy adults, skipping one day of eating is not without potential side effects.

  • Hunger and Irritability: The most common side effect is intense hunger, which can lead to irritability and mood swings, often referred to as being "hangry." These feelings are caused by spikes in the hunger hormone, ghrelin, but typically subside as the fast progresses.
  • Fatigue and Headaches: You may experience fatigue, low energy, and headaches, especially during your first fasts. These symptoms are often a result of your body adjusting to the shift in its primary fuel source from glucose to fat.
  • Dehydration: Without consuming food, you miss out on a significant source of water. This makes it essential to drink plenty of fluids, including water and herbal teas, during your fasting period to prevent dehydration.
  • Disordered Eating Patterns: For some individuals, especially those with a history of eating disorders, fasting can trigger unhealthy binge-restrict cycles and psychological distress.

Comparison Table: 24-Hour Fast vs. Standard Calorie Restriction

Feature 24-Hour Fast Daily Calorie Restriction (Traditional Diet)
Mechanism Calorie intake is restricted on fasting days, prompting a metabolic switch to fat burning (ketosis). A small reduction in daily caloric intake is maintained over time.
Weight Loss Effectiveness Can lead to significant short-term weight reduction, largely from water weight initially. Long-term effectiveness is comparable to daily calorie restriction. A consistent and slow-paced method for weight loss over a longer period.
Metabolic Shift Pushes the body into a state of ketosis, improving metabolic flexibility and insulin sensitivity. Relies on a slight, consistent caloric deficit, without a major shift in fuel source.
Hormonal Response Creates fluctuations in hunger hormones (ghrelin) and stress hormones (cortisol). Can also boost growth hormone temporarily. More stable hormone levels, though continuous dieting can also affect them.
Sustainability Can be difficult to maintain for some due to intense hunger and side effects. Binge eating risk is a factor. Often considered easier to sustain long-term for many people, depending on the severity of the deficit.
Digestive Impact Allows the digestive system to rest for a full 24 hours, potentially reducing bloating for some. Continuous processing of food, without extended rest periods.

Who Should Not Fast for a Day?

While fasting is relatively safe for many, certain populations should avoid or exercise extreme caution when considering a 24-hour fast, always consulting a healthcare provider first.

  • Individuals with Diabetes: Fasting can cause dangerously low blood sugar levels (hypoglycemia), especially for those on insulin or other diabetes medications.
  • People with a History of Eating Disorders: Fasting can be a trigger for relapse or worsening symptoms for individuals with a history of anorexia, bulimia, or binge eating disorder.
  • Pregnant or Breastfeeding Women: Fasting can deprive both the mother and child of essential nutrients and calories needed for proper development and milk production.
  • Children and Adolescents: Fasting is not recommended for children and teens, as they are in a critical period of growth and development that requires consistent nourishment.
  • Individuals on Certain Medications: Some medications, especially those that need to be taken with food, can have altered effects or cause side effects when taken on an empty stomach.
  • Those Undergoing Cancer Treatment: For some situations and cancer types, fasting could have negative effects, and should only be done under strict medical supervision within a clinical trial setting.
